What You’ll Need
- 3-4 pieces bo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 1.5 lbs)
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 2 large eggs
- 1 cup Italian-seasoned breadcrumbs
- 2 cups canned crushed tomatoes
- 2 cloves fresh garlic (minced)
- 1 tsp dried oregano
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
Consider swapping out the mozzarella for provolone for a different cheese flavor, or adding some fresh basil for an herbaceous touch.

Directions to Follow
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and lightly spray a baking dish with nonstick cooking spray.
- Season your chicken breasts generously with salt and pepper.
- Dredge each chicken breast in flour, ensuring it’s fully coated.
- Dip the floured chicken in beaten eggs, allowing any excess to drip off.
- Coat them in Italian-seasoned breadcrumbs for that perfect crunch.
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Sear each chicken breast for about 3 minutes on each side until golden brown.
- In a saucepan, combine the crushed tomatoes, minced garlic, oregano, salt, and pepper. Let this simmer for about 10 minutes to meld the flavors beautifully.
- Place the seared chicken in your prepared baking dish. Pour the tomato sauce over each piece.
- Generously sprinkle mozzarella and Parmesan cheese over the top.
-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and golden brown. Serve hot and enjoy!

Storage and Reheating Tips
Leftovers? No problem! Allow the Chicken Parmesan to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It will stay fresh in the refrigerator for 3-4 days. To reheat, place it in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) until heated through. Avoid the microwave if you can—keeping that crispy texture is key!
Helpful Cooking Tips
- For an extra crispy coating, try double-dipping the chicken in the egg and breadcrumbs.
- Using freshly grated Parmesan instead of pre-grated can significantly boost the flavor.
- If you prefer a spicier kick, a pinch of red pepper flakes in the sauce can elevate the dish.
Recipe Variations
Feel free to get creative with this Chicken Parmesan! You can try substituting the crushed tomatoes for a store-bought marinara sauce for a shortcut. For a healthier twist, bake the chicken without frying it first. If you’re looking for a gluten-free option, use gluten-free breadcrumbs and flour!

Can I make it 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the chicken up to the baking step, cover it tightly, and refrigerate overnight. Just add a few extra minutes to the baking time.
